Why the combination of Ascorbic Acid derivatives and Sodium Hyaluronate dominates the clinical anti-aging market.
L-Ascorbic acid is notoriously unstable, prone to rapid oxidation upon exposure to light, air, and water. Our professional formulation integrates high-purity Vitamin C derivatives (such as 3-O-Ethyl Ascorbic Acid, Sodium Ascorby Phosphate, and Ascorbyl Glucoside) suspended within a viscoelastic Hyaluronic Acid polymer matrix. This structural barrier limits oxygen diffusion, extending the active shelf life and ensuring peak bio-efficacy upon topical application.
Hyaluronic acid functions as a smart humectant and delivery vehicle. By utilizing a optimized multi-molecular weight profile (combining high molecular weight HA for surface barrier function and Oligo/Low molecular weight HA for deep penetration), we facilitate the transdermal migration of hydrophilic Vitamin C. This dual-action pathway ensures that active antioxidants reach the basal layer of the epidermis, stimulating fibroblasts to synthesize collagen.
While Vitamin C actively neutralizes reactive oxygen species (ROS) induced by UV radiation and environmental pollutants, Hyaluronic Acid maintains intercellular moisture retention. Together, they target two main pathways of extrinsic skin aging: dry micro-fissures and dermal structural collapse. The resulting serum restores the skin barrier, reduces hyperpigmentation, and provides long-lasting hydration without causing irritation.
In manufacturing a stable Vitamin C Hyaluronic Acid serum, pH maintenance is critical. True L-ascorbic acid requires an acidic environment (pH < 3.5) to remain un-ionized and penetrate the skin, which can degrade standard high-molecular-weight hyaluronic acid. China is the global leader in Sodium Hyaluronate production via Streptococcus zooepidemicus fermentation. This bio-fermentation method eliminates risk of animal-derived pathogen contamination, yielding exceptionally high purity (assay >98%), low protein impurity, and predictable molecular weight spreads. How forward-thinking brands utilize Vitamin C Hyaluronic Acid active serums across distinct target channels.
Following non-invasive cosmetic procedures such as microneedling, laser resurfacing, or chemical peels, skin is compromised with temporary barrier breakdown. Combining Low Molecular Weight Hyaluronic Acid with Vitamin C derivatives offers optimal recovery support. HA speeds epidermal healing, while Vit C reduces post-inflammatory hyperpigmentation (PIH) and promotes neo-collagenesis.
